3D Printing in Oral Surgery



To enhance the area of dental surgery, you can discover the subtopic of 3D printing in oral surgery. a knockout post -edge technology has the prospective to reinvent the way oral specialists operate and deal with patients. Right here are 4 key methods which 3D printing is forming the area:

- ** Personalized Surgical Guides **: 3D printing enables the creation of very accurate and patient-specific medical guides, enhancing the accuracy and performance of treatments.

- ** Implant Prosthetics **: With 3D printing, dental specialists can produce customized implant prosthetics that flawlessly fit a client's one-of-a-kind makeup, causing better results and person fulfillment.

- ** Bone Grafting **: 3D printing enables the manufacturing of patient-specific bone grafts, reducing the requirement for conventional grafting techniques and enhancing healing and healing time.

- ** Education and learning and Educating **: 3D printing can be used to develop practical medical versions for academic purposes, enabling dental doctors to practice intricate treatments prior to executing them on people.

With its prospective to boost accuracy, modification, and training, 3D printing is an amazing growth in the field of dental surgery.

Minimally Invasive Strategies



To even more advance the field of oral surgery, accept the capacity of minimally intrusive strategies that can substantially profit both cosmetic surgeons and clients alike.

These methods include using smaller sized cuts and specialized tools to carry out treatments with precision and efficiency.

By using advanced imaging modern technology, such as cone light beam calculated tomography (CBCT), cosmetic surgeons can accurately plan and implement surgical procedures with marginal invasiveness.

In addition, making use of lasers in oral surgery enables exact cells cutting and coagulation, leading to lessened blood loss and lowered healing time.

With minimally invasive methods, individuals can experience quicker recovery, decreased scarring, and improved results, making it a necessary facet of the future of dental surgery.
